The Piaggio P.166 is a twin-engine pusher-type utility aircraft developed by the Italian aircraft manufacturer Piaggio Aero. Its first flight occured on 26 November 1957. With ten seats (and twelve for the C subtype), this aircraft met some success both on the civil and the military market. More 500 were built.
